#2c0212 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c0212 is composed of 17.3% red, 0.8%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.5% magenta, 59.1%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 337.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 9%. #2c0212 color hex could be obtained by blending #580424 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

● #2c0212 color description : Very dark (mostly black) pink.
#2c0212 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c0212 has RGB values of R:44, G:2,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.59, K:0.83. Its decimal value is 2884114.
